[dpdk-dev,v6,1/6] mbuf: add flag for MACsec
Checks
Commit Message
Add a new Tx flag in mbuf, that can be set by applications to
enable the MACsec offload for a packet to be transmitted.
Signed-off-by: Tiwei Bie <tiwei.bie@intel.com>
---
doc/guides/rel_notes/release_17_02.rst | 5 +++++
lib/librte_mbuf/rte_mbuf.c | 2 ++
lib/librte_mbuf/rte_mbuf.h | 6 ++++++
3 files changed, 13 insertions(+)
